Can someone tell me what I have for application, the flange bolt pattern is: outermost holes center to center are 19 7/8", the outer port is 3 3/16" center to center and the inner ports center to center are 5 5/8" the tubes are 1 7/8" and 3 1/2" collector. Want to make sure they are B.B. Mopar and what they fit.
